In this engaging discussion, Anthony Scarpaci, a growth leader and consultant with a strong background in fintech and consumer brands, unveils his RIGHTT Framework for effective referral programs. He emphasizes the importance of aligning incentives with product value and shares insights on creating urgency with rewards. Anthony dives into the balance between preventing fraud and usability, and how human-centric experiences build trust. Real-world examples, like GoHunt and Dish Network, illustrate his points, making this a must-listen for anyone interested in referral marketing.

Map And Humanize The Referral Journey

  • Map every referral touchpoint end-to-end and keep messaging consistent across ads, onboarding, sharing, and reward delivery.
  • Reinforce trust and clearly show both sides' rewards at each step to reduce confusion and friction.

Wait For Fit, Then Measure Incrementality

  • Launch referrals only after product-market fit and a meaningful customer base to avoid harming organic word-of-mouth.
  • Measure cohorts and blended CAC to understand true incremental value before scaling.

Examples: GoHunt And Dish Network

  • GoHunt ties referral points to its e-commerce gear store so rewards enhance the hunting experience for both sides.
  • Dish Network initially used cash gift cards but later shifted to content-related rewards to better align with product value.
